Documentation ¶
Index ¶
- func ClusterRoleBinding(namespace string) reconciling.NamedClusterRoleBindingCreatorGetter
- func ClusterRoleCreator() (string, reconciling.ClusterRoleCreator)
- func DeploymentCreator(data userclusterControllerData) reconciling.NamedDeploymentCreatorGetter
- func GenClusterRoleBindingName(targetNamespace string) string
- func RoleBindingCreator() (string, reconciling.RoleBindingCreator)
- func RoleCreator() (string, reconciling.RoleCreator)
- func ServiceAccountCreator() (string, reconciling.ServiceAccountCreator)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func ClusterRoleBinding ¶ added in v2.17.0
func ClusterRoleBinding(namespace string) reconciling.NamedClusterRoleBindingCreatorGetter
func ClusterRoleCreator ¶ added in v2.17.0
func ClusterRoleCreator() (string, reconciling.ClusterRoleCreator)
func DeploymentCreator ¶
func DeploymentCreator(data userclusterControllerData) reconciling.NamedDeploymentCreatorGetter
DeploymentCreator returns the function to create and update the user cluster controller deployment nolint:gocyclo
func GenClusterRoleBindingName ¶ added in v2.17.0
func RoleBindingCreator ¶
func RoleBindingCreator() (string, reconciling.RoleBindingCreator)
func RoleCreator ¶
func RoleCreator() (string, reconciling.RoleCreator)
func ServiceAccountCreator ¶
func ServiceAccountCreator() (string, reconciling.ServiceAccountCreator)
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.